Olaoye Muibat Adesewa Child Care Foundation (OMACCF) celebrated its One-Year Anniversary on October 1st, 2025, at the Ministry of Education, District II, Maryland, Lagos State. The milestone event brought together representatives from 20 schools under District II, with each school represented by five students and one counselor, teacher, or principal. This impressive turnout reflected OMACCF’s growing influence and its unwavering dedication to promoting child welfare and education.
The anniversary celebration was not only a moment of gratitude and reflection but also an educational and empowerment-driven program. It was specifically designed to equip students, parents, teachers, and guardians with vital knowledge on child health, hygiene, and basic first aid practices, ensuring they are capable of responding effectively in emergencies and fostering healthier, safer environments for children.
A major highlight of the event was the participation of notable partners and resource persons, including Mrs. Beatrice Makinde, Director of LASAMBUS, who delivered an insightful address on child health and safety. In addition, representatives from Emergency Response Africa facilitated a comprehensive First Aid Sensitization and Awareness Session, during which attendees were taught practical steps for managing medical emergencies involving children. Furthermore, the Head of Department, Guidance and Counseling, and her office played a crucial role in overseeing and coordinating the entire program, ensuring its smooth and successful execution.
Through these impactful contributions and the active participation of students, teachers, and parents, the OMACCF One-Year Anniversary event successfully reaffirmed the Foundation’s mission to nurture, educate, and safeguard the next generation through awareness, compassion, and community action.
